Where do Mosquitoes Breed?Mosquitoes breed in any still or stagnant water. They do not breed in running streams, but they carry out in pools, ponds and even bayous and other wetland habitats. It does not take a great leap of good sense to then see that they will also breed in garden ponds, old can, watering cans, obstructed rain gutters, bird baths and other locations where water can gather and stagnate.
